About Mochi
He is a dog with some attitude and can be very vocal. He loves to cuddle and being around other dogs and children. He is very gentle with children. He isn't a cat dog at all He will go after them. He needs someone that can walk him twice a day does not do good in a backyard He will jump the fence or find a way out.
